HoxC4 Activators

HoxC4 Activators refer to a specific category of chemical compounds that exhibit the unique ability to modulate the activity of the HoxC4 gene. The HoxC4 gene is a member of the Hox gene family, which plays a crucial role in embryonic development and the establishment of body patterns in various organisms, including humans. HoxC4, in particular, is implicated in the regulation of cell differentiation and tissue development, making it a key player in embryogenesis. The activators identified within this chemical class possess the capacity to enhance the expression or function of HoxC4, thereby influencing downstream molecular events associated with cellular differentiation and tissue specification.

Structurally, HoxC4 activators often demonstrate a specific interaction with regulatory elements of the HoxC4 gene, such as enhancers or promoter regions. This interaction may result in a conformational change in the gene, facilitating increased binding of transcription factors or other regulatory proteins, ultimately leading to heightened HoxC4 gene expression. The specificity of these activators for HoxC4 sets them apart from broader transcriptional regulators, allowing for a more targeted and nuanced modulation of cellular processes associated with embryonic development.
